WebMar 31, 2024 · A will is a document that directs the distribution of your assets after your death to your designated heirs and beneficiaries. It also can include your instructions for … WebApr 13, 2024 · A private family trust company (PFTC) is an entity designed to serve as trustee for a single family’s trusts. While the Wyoming Division of Banking regulates the closely related chartered private trust company, it does not regulate the PFTC. That said, when a family form a PFTC, it needs to be aware of the applicable federal and state law. st mary background
